A visual representation illustrating the various external components of a Toyota Tacoma is a valuable tool for identifying, locating, and understanding the assembly of its body. It presents a detailed view of individual panels, trim pieces, and structural elements that constitute the vehicle’s exterior. For instance, it can show the precise positioning of the front bumper cover, the arrangement of fender flares, or the composition of the tailgate assembly.
The availability and utilization of these schematics are significantly important for collision repair, restoration projects, and general maintenance. This visual aid facilitates accurate part ordering, reduces the likelihood of assembly errors, and contributes to a more efficient repair process. Historically, such diagrams were primarily available in paper format through service manuals. However, with advancements in technology, these representations are now commonly accessed digitally through online databases and software applications.
